What Is Considered an HVAC Emergency?

Not every HVAC issue requires a 2 AM phone call. But some situations are true emergencies. If you have a total loss of heat during a freezing Texas cold snap, that's an emergency, especially for families with young children or elderly members. An AC failure in the middle of a 100-degree July heatwave is another. Safety issues always come first: a strong gas smell, your carbon monoxide alarm going off, electrical burning smells from your unit, or a major water leak from your AC system inside your home are all clear signs to call for emergency HVAC service immediately.

Common HVAC Problems Homeowners See in Little Elm

Walking into a stuffy house on a hot day because your AC isn't cooling is a common frustration here. Furnaces that won't ignite on a chilly morning are another frequent call. We often see frozen coils from dirty filters or low refrigerant, and clogged condensate lines that cause AC units to leak water inside the house. Failing capacitors or blower motors, thermostat glitches, and poor airflow are other regular issues. One homeowner near Little Elm Park called us when their CO alarm kept chirping; it turned out to be a cracked heat exchanger in their old furnace—a serious but fixable safety hazard. Another family in Paloma Creek had water pooling under their indoor air handler every time the AC ran; a simple cleaning of the drain line solved it.

Emergency HVAC vs. Same-Day vs. Routine Service

Knowing when to call can save you stress and money. You should call for emergency HVAC service immediately for safety risks (like gas smells) or total system failure during extreme weather. Same-day HVAC service is perfect for problems that are uncomfortable but not dangerous—like weak cooling on a hot day or a furnace that's cycling on and off. For things like a seasonal tune-up, a strange noise you've noticed for a week, or scheduling a replacement, routine HVAC service during normal business hours is the way to go. Understanding this difference is key to getting the right HVAC service in Little Elm.

A Transparent Look at HVAC Service Costs

We believe in being upfront about pricing. Most HVAC service calls start with a diagnostic fee, which covers the technician's time to find the problem. For an emergency call-out, especially after hours, on weekends, or holidays, there is typically an additional emergency fee. Labor rates during these times may also be higher. The final cost includes parts, any necessary labor, and sometimes permit fees for major work like a new system installation. As an example, a simple capacitor replacement during a weekday might cost a few hundred dollars total, while an after-hours repair on a Saturday night for a failed inducer motor could be more. These are estimates, as costs vary based on the specific repair and parts needed.

Signs You Need Immediate HVAC Service

  • No heat when outdoor temperatures are below freezing.
  • Your carbon monoxide alarm is sounding.
  • You smell a strong odor of natural gas or rotten eggs.
  • You see smoke or smell burning coming from your HVAC equipment.
  • Water is pooling from your indoor AC unit or air handler.
  • There are loud banging, screeching, or electrical buzzing noises.
  • Your AC has completely failed during a period of dangerous heat.

What to Do While You Wait for Help (Safety Checklist)

  • If you smell gas, evacuate the house immediately and call your gas utility from outside. Do not operate light switches.
  • If your CO alarm sounds, get everyone, including pets, outside to fresh air right away.
  • If it is safe to do so, turn off your HVAC system at the thermostat and the circuit breaker.
  • Keep a safe distance from any electrical components that are sparking or smoking.
  • Move children, elderly family members, or anyone with health conditions to a safer location, like a neighbor's house with power.
  • Remember, never attempt to repair gas lines or high-voltage electrical components yourself.

Local Codes, Permits, and Why Licensing Matters

In Little Elm and across Texas, there are important rules for HVAC work. Proper furnace venting is critical to prevent carbon monoxide hazards. Handling refrigerants requires an EPA Section 608 certification. For major jobs like replacing a full system, a permit from the city may be required to ensure the installation meets current codes. Hiring a licensed HVAC service provider in Little Elm, TX, means the work will be done right, safely, and legally, protecting your home and your family's well-being.
